Ways to Access TikTok on Your Laptop

You have several options when it comes to accessing TikTok on your laptop. Let’s explore each method in detail.

1. Using the TikTok Website

One of the simplest ways to access TikTok is through its official website. Here’s how you can do it:

  1. Open any web browser on your laptop.
  2. Type in the URL: www.tiktok.com
  3. Sign in with your credentials or browse content without an account.

While this method does not allow video creation or uploading, you can still watch and engage with content through likes and comments.

2. TikTok Desktop App

Another option is to download the TikTok desktop application. Currently available for Windows, this app mirrors many mobile features, allowing users to create and edit videos efficiently.

How to Download the TikTok Desktop App

To download and install the TikTok app on your laptop:

  1. Go to the Microsoft Store on your Windows laptop.
  2. Search for “TikTok” in the store.
  3. Click on the download button and wait for the installation to finish.
  4. Open the application and sign in.

This method will give you a more comprehensive TikTok experience compared to simply using the browser.

3. Using an Android Emulator

If you’re looking to enjoy the full app functionality, including creating and uploading videos, consider using an Android emulator. This software simulates an Android device on your laptop.

Popular Android Emulators

There are several Android emulators available, but the most popular ones include:

  • BlueStacks
  • NoxPlayer

Steps to Use an Android Emulator

Using an emulator to access TikTok involves the following steps:

  1. Download your preferred emulator from its official website.
  2. Install the emulator following on-screen instructions.
  3. Open the emulator and access the Google Play Store.
  4. Search for “TikTok” and download the application.
  5. Launch TikTok within the emulator and log in.

This approach allows for the most unrestricted access to TikTok’s features, making it a great option for content creators.

Potential Drawbacks of Using TikTok on a Laptop

Despite the benefits, there are a few drawbacks to consider:

Limited Features

While the TikTok website and desktop app offer a range of functionalities, they still do not match the full capabilities of the mobile app, particularly in video creation.

Compatibility Issues

Some emulators may experience performance issues or bugs, affecting your user experience. Always ensure you’re using a reputable emulator to minimize these problems.

How can I access TikTok on my laptop?

To access TikTok on your laptop, you can use the official TikTok website or download the Microsoft Store app if you’re using Windows. Simply open your preferred web browser, type in the URL “www.tiktok.com,” and log in with your account credentials. The website provides a user-friendly interface for browsing videos and interacting with your favorite content creators.

Alternatively, you can download the TikTok app for Windows from the Microsoft Store. Search for “TikTok” in the store, download, and install the application. Once installed, you can log in, explore, and enjoy TikTok videos just like you would on a mobile device.

Do I need to create a new account to use TikTok on my laptop?

No, you do not need to create a new account to use TikTok on your laptop. If you already have a TikTok account, you can log in using your existing credentials. Just enter your username and password after accessing the website or launching the desktop app.

If you do not have an account yet, you can easily sign up using your email, phone number, or by linking an existing social media profile directly through the platform. This feature makes it convenient for new users to join TikTok and start exploring content immediately.

Can I upload videos to TikTok from my laptop?

Yes, you can upload videos to TikTok from your laptop, although the process may differ slightly from using a mobile device. When using the TikTok website, you will find an upload button that allows you to select video files from your computer. Be sure that your videos meet TikTok’s requirements regarding format and length.

However, the desktop experience may not be as seamless as the mobile app for editing and adding special effects before posting. Therefore, it’s recommended to edit your videos on your computer using video editing software before uploading them to TikTok through your laptop.

What are some limitations of using TikTok on a laptop?

When using TikTok on a laptop, there are a few limitations compared to the mobile app. For instance, video editing options are more limited. While you can upload pre-edited videos, many editing features available on mobile, such as filters, effects, and sounds, are not fully accessible on the desktop version.

Moreover, some interactive elements and user experiences, such as touch gestures and camera features for recording, are absent on a laptop. Thus, for users who prefer creative engagement through the app’s editing tools, using a mobile device may provide a more enriched experience.

Is it safe to use TikTok on my laptop?

Using TikTok on your laptop is generally safe, but it is essential to consider standard online safety practices. Make sure you are accessing the official TikTok website or app from a trusted source. Avoid third-party sites that offer unverified versions of TikTok, as they may pose security risks.

Furthermore, it’s wise to keep your operating system and browser updated to protect against potential vulnerabilities. Ensure that you are also cautious when sharing personal information and interacting with other users, as internet safety rules apply regardless of the device you are using.
